Rich Pieri wrote:
> A power off state does not disable this "feature" on smart
> phones and some feature phones. Either remove the battery
> or stuff it in a static bag (Faraday cage).

Eyebrows raised...that statement doesn't sound right.  I expect that a device
I own won't drain its battery if I turn it off.  GPS radio receivers draw
quite a bit of power, and 3G/4G transmitters probably draw even more.

If your statement about power-off were true, I would expect that phones with
even the biggest battery would drain within a week or two.

Battery removal works for (most) Android devices but Apple long ago decided
not to provide user-removable/replaceable batteries.
